    Who We Are Looking For

    Crisis24 is building a new team of intelligence analysts to be located at our Annapolis headquarters to join the Embedded Intelligence Services (EIS) division. Under the Crisis24 Program Manager's general supervision, these intelligence analysts will perform global threat monitoring, intelligence analysis and production, investigative research, and disaster response support for our client, a industry-leading company in the professional services sector. This team will operate 24/7/365 and therefore requires shiftwork, to include nights, weekends, and occasional holiday coverage.

    What You Will Work On

    • Actively monitor open-source media, third-party subscription services, and other sources in real time for global and regional events that could affect client business operations and personnel
    • Assess threats to client operations, including security, health, environment, reputational, and industry-specific events
    • Provide timely, comprehensive, and value-added intelligence products tailored to decision makers' needs
    • Prepare threat assessments and situation reports to various business lines and stakeholders across the enterprise
    • Monitor social media for threats to client personnel and business interests and conduct open-source investigations for online exposure assessments and threat actors
    • Support regional physical security liaisons as needed
    • Independently assess and respond to security incidents, exercising sound judgment and initiative in decision-making
    • Understand the client's footprint and interests to anticipate client needs
    • Follow escalation procedures to communicate threats and company exposure to client POCs; conduct client employee outreach
    • Track and report metrics around production and deliverables
    • Apply critical thinking skills to evaluate complex intelligence data and identify patterns, trends, and potential risks.
    • Demonstrate adaptability in rapidly changing environments, effectively adjusting strategies and priorities to meet evolving needs.
    • Exercise meticulous attention to detail in all aspects of intelligence analysis, ensuring accuracy and precision in reporting and decision-making.
    • Engage in cross-project analysis, including consistent sharing of information among fellow analysts on the team and across EIS
    • Be consistently engaged on a daily basis with teammates, peers, and team leadership
    • Shift work is required to meet the client's 24/7/365 mission

    What You Will Bring

    • 1-3 years of experience in intelligence analysis, threat assessment, incident response, security operations or a related field required
    • Bachelor's degree in relevant field required
    • Excellent research skills
    • Excellent verbal communication skills
    • Exceptional writing skills
    • Familiarity with structured analytic techniques and data analysis a plus
    • Knowledge of Microsoft Office, especially Word, Excel, PowerPoint (PowerBI a plus)
    • Knowledge of Google Earth and Maps (ArcGIS or QGIS a plus)
    • Effective problem-solving skills
    • Customer service experience preferred
    • Fast learner and ability to follow standard operating procedures
    • Ability to organize and prioritize work with little supervision
    • Ability to work well as part of a team
    • Ability to adhere to timelines and deadlines with effective time management skills
    • Establishing and maintaining positive professional rapport with other analysts, team leadership, as well as with client contacts
    • Foreign language and global travel experience is a plus
